Directions:

  1. Cut the pork tenderloin into 3/4 inch slices.
  2. Pound the slices until each is about 1/4” thick.
  3. Place the cracker meal in a dish (aluminum pie pans work great).
  4. In a second dish, beat eggs with milk.
  5. Dip each slice in the egg and then in the cracker meal. Coat well.
  6. Fry in a skillet with 1/2 butter and 1/2 olive oil until golden brown.
  7. Serve on a hamburger bun with your choice of condiments.
